#Rio2016: Nigeria’s Aruna Quadri Makes History At The Olympics
Aruna’s place in the quarter-finals, Monday, August 8, was secured by a four-two win against German opponent, Boll Timo.
Boll Timo ranked number ten in Rio.
Prior to Monday’s game, Nigeria’s Aruna Quadri was “at par” with Segun Toriola. Toriola made it to the fourth round at the 2008 Beijing Olympic Games in China.
When he played against his German opponent, Timo, Aruna Quadri won the first three sets 12-10 12-10, 12-5 in ten minutes.

Timo took the fourth and fifth set 11-3, 11-5
However, in the sixth set, Quadri’s will of steel caused him an 11-9 win. Securing his pace in Olympic history.
